The challenge

UK Power Networks own, construct and maintain the electricity infrastructure across London, the Southeast and East of England. The General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) is key to protecting individuals’ fundamental rights and freedoms, particularly the right to protect personal data and ensuring it’s treated properly and fairly.

With all the privacy controls already in place to ensure adherence to the regulations, but with very manual processes – managed across emails, forms and excel spreadsheets and other disparate systems, the Data Protection Officer (DPO) wanted to reduce complexity, enforce a consistent process and reduce the compliance impact on workloads across the business. As regulatory regimes become tighter and volume and breadth of regulation increases, doing more for less is critical.

Streamlined, fast and failsafe

UK Power Networks wanted the processing to be more transparent, keeping everything in one place with the assurance that nothing was ever missed. It also needed to be easier for the Data Protection team, as well as other staff who champion data protection in their departments, to keep on top of compliance alongside their day-to-day tasks and responsibilities.

Liberty Create, our low-code platform, had been used on multiple projects and systems within UK Power Networks and members of the Data Protection Team had experience of using it to develop applications. It was the natural selection to build a Compliance Management application.

“The new digital processes ensure adherence and compliance, rather than the team spending a high proportion of their time chasing activities to meet the necessary compliance steps. It provides us with the framework to minimise the potential for any breaches or fines, as well as reducing admin time for colleagues across the business. We’ve moved from labour intensive and manual processes to a system that’s automated, organised, easy to track and audit, highly visible and ‘all under one roof’.”

The result

  • Efficiency: Automated processes reduce errors, admin time and speed up data processing
  • Unified information: All data is in one system for easy access for all
  • Audit trail: Full compliance evidence is provided
  • Collaboration: Data Champions engage more with processes, suggesting improvements due to seeing the speed of improvements
  • Automated logs: Register of processing activity is automatically generated, replacing a manual spreadsheet.
